| Bathroom Styles | Features |
|---|---|
| Contemporary | Clean lines, neutral palettes, and innovative fixtures |
| Traditional | Classic fixtures, detailed moldings, and warm tones |
| Industrial | Exposed pipes, metal accents, and rugged finishes |
| Farmhouse | Rustic wood elements, apron sinks, and cozy textures |
| Luxury Spa | High-end fixtures, soaking tubs, and ambient lighting |
